2001 Honda VFR800F
TYPE: Sport touring
| Engine and transmission |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Displacement: | 782.00 ccm (47.72 cubic inches) | Power: | 106 |
| Engine type: | V4 | Stroke: | 4 |
| Bore x stroke: | 72.0 x 48.0 mm (2.8 x 1.9 inches) | Gearbox: | 6-speed |
| Cooling system: | Compression: | ||
| Physical measures and capacities | |
|---|---|
| Dry weight: | 208.0 kg (458.6 pounds) |
| Seat height: | 805 mm (31.7 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ting. |
| Wheelbase: | 1,440 mm (56.7 inches) |
| Brakes, suspension, Frame and wheels | |
|---|---|
| Front tyre dimensions: | 120/70-ZR17 |
| Rear tyre dimensions: | 180/55-ZR17 |
| Front brakes: | Dual disc |
| Rear brakes: | Single disc |
| Other specs | |
|---|---|
| Fuel capacity: | 21.00 litres (5.55 gallons) |
| Starter: | Electric |
